Microplegic Solution No. 1 is a specialized cardioplegia solution used during cardiac surgery to induce and maintain cardiac arrest, allowing surgeons to operate on a still and bloodless heart. Unlike standard cardioplegia, which often uses a mixture of blood and crystalloid in ratios such as 4:1, microplegia typically involves the use of undiluted or minimally diluted patient blood mixed with concentrated additives (such as potassium chloride, magnesium sulfate, lidocaine) delivered via specialized systems like the MPS2 Microplegia delivery machine by Quest Medical. The goal is to provide myocardial protection while minimizing hemodilution and reducing perioperative transfusion requirements[2][7]. Microplegic solutions are designed for rapid onset of cardiac arrest with reduced volume load compared to traditional methods[4][7]. The mechanism of action involves high potassium-induced depolarization arrest of myocardial cells along with adjuncts that stabilize cell membranes and reduce ischemia-reperfusion injury.
